Crete is home to 11+ indigenous grape varieties.
These are just 4 of our favorites.
Manousakis Winery- Nostos Romeiko
🍇 Romeiko is a red though this is a white wine. It is the most widely planted grape variety in Chania. You'll find it as a white, rose, and as delicious sun-dried dessert wines.

Patriotis Winery Muscat of Spina
🍇 Muscat of Spina
Spina is a village in the south of Chania that has been producing Muscat grapes for millenia. Don't fret, almost all Muscat of Spina is dry though the nose is bursting with peach, apricot, and white flowers.
Dourakis Winery- Lihnos Vidiano
🍇 Vidiano
Vidiano is our most versatile white wine. It can be fermented in stainless steel, clay, and barrel (sometimes all three in the same wine!). This Vidiano spends time in French oak and emerges with vanilla cream, apple pie, and peach cobbler notes.
Karavitakis Winery Kotsifali
🍇 Kotsifali
Kotsifali is one of 4 red grape varieties on Crete. It's known for it's vibrant cranberry and raspberry aroma and bright acidity on the palate. This ungrafted, wild fermented, aged Kotsifali from old vines will knock your socks off.
